Job Description
American Traveler is seeking an experienced RN for a Neonatal ICU night shift position requiring an OK or compact RN license and at least one year of NICU experience.
Responsibilities- Work in the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it in a hospital setting
- Care for critically ill neonates and premature infants
- Night shifts from 6:45 PM to 7:15 AM, three 12-hour shifts per week
- 13-week contract assignment
- Responsible for comprehensive nursing care and documentation for assigned neonatal patients
- Administers medications, IV infusions, and monitors patient responses
- Collaborates with physicians and healthcare team for diagnostic and therapeutic procedures
- Engages with patient families regarding care plans and discharge education
- Delegates tasks to support staff as appropriate
- 50-mile radius rule applies; no local candidates accepted
- Holiday coverage may be required
- Current Oklahoma RN or valid multistate compact RN license
- Minimum one year of NICU nursing experience required
- Associate's Degree in Nursing from an accredited program required
- Active BLS and NRP certifications from the American Heart Association required
- BSN preferred
